Webb11 okt. 2024 · Yellow berried firethorn (Pyracantha koidzumii) is an evergreen shrub often grown as a hedge. The shrub can be trained up a fence and grow to 15 feet tall. It has dark, spiny foliage and clusters of orange-yellow berries in the fall. The berries are popular with birds and are also edible to humans; they are often used to make jelly. WebbReal Food Encyclopedia Ground Cherries. The ground cherry, also called physalis or cape gooseberry) is a unique fruit. With its papery husk, it looks like a small, orange tomatillo, but its flavor is uniquely sweet: to our palate, a mixture of pineapple, strawberry and green grapes — sweet, tart and vaguely tropical.

WebbChokeberries. The fruit is a small pome and has a very bitter flavor. There are two species of chokeberries, red chokeberry, and black chokeberry. The purple chokeberry is a hybrid of the two berries listed above. It is used to make juices, jam, wine, etc. It is also used as a flavoring and coloring agent.
